Conte Makes 2 Changes As Duo Return: Predicted Chelsea Line-Up vs Everton

Chelsea take on Everton at Stamford Bridge on Sunday afternoon. Here is the side we think Antonio Conte will pick for the game:

Chelsea will look to build on their 2-1 victory over Tottenham last weekend when they take on Everton at Stamford Bridge on Sunday afternoon.

Here is the side we think Antonio Conte will pick for the game:

Goalkeeper: Thibaut Courtois is certain to keep his place between the sticks this weekend unless he picks up a late injury.

Defence: Conte will continue to be without skipper Gary Cahill as he serves the second of his three-game ban so Antonio Rudiger should continue at the back.

Andreas Christensen was impressive against Tottenham last week but I think we might see the youngster drop back to the bench as David Luiz should return to the back three following his stint in midfield.

Cesar Azpilicueta should continue in his role on the right side of the back three after another excellent display at Wembley last weekend.

Midfield: Marcos Alonso was the hero against Spurs as he scored two superb goals to secure the win so the Spaniard is certain to continue in the left wing-back position on Sunday.

Victor Moses made his return from suspension last time out and he should keep his place on the right while Cesc Fabregas is back in contention after serving his one-match ban.

Conte tinkered with his formation to pack the midfield against Tottenham but he could revert to a more familiar 3-4-2-1 against Everton meaning one of his midfielders will drop out.

N’Golo Kante is certain to keep his place so Tiemoue Bakayoko could be the man most likely to make way as he was rushed back from a knee injury to play against Spurs so he could be given a breather, despite putting in an excellent display.

Attack: If Conte does change back to his usual formation then we should see Pedro recalled to the starting eleven while Willian is expected to keep his place in attack.

Alvaro Morata made his full debut up front last weekend and he should keep his place ahead of Michy Batshuay but Diego Costa continues to be exiled from the squad.

Eden Hazard stepped-up his recovery from a broken foot by playing for the under-23’s tonight but he isn’t ready to return to the first team just yet.
